Job Summary

Set up, process, and settle first-party and third-party low-severity automobile and property claims within established limits. You’ll contact policyholders and claimants, verify coverage, set reserves, issue payments, enter loss information in the claims system, and keep pending claims moving with timely correspondence and reviews. The role reports to the Raleigh Branch office and includes obtaining required state licensing shortly after starting.

Key Responsibilities

  • •Settle claims within limits of authority by contacting policyholders/claimants, verifying coverage, setting reserves, and issuing payments using approved methods.
  • •Process first-party automobile, third-party clear liability automobile, and low severity property claims.
  • •Establish and maintain contact with parties involved in the claim per company expectations.
  • •Handle inquiries from policyholders, agents, insurance carriers, claimants, and others.
  • •Enter loss information into the claims system, prepare correspondence/forms, and regularly review pending claims and activities.

Key Requirements

  • •High school diploma or GED and one year of related claims handling, customer service, or clerical experience.
  • •Obtain appropriate licenses as required by state within 45 days of employment (external applicants).
  • •Process first-party automobile, third-party clear liability automobile, and low severity property claims within limits of authority.
  • •Able to complete manual keying/data entry/computer use frequently (50–80%).
  • •Pursuit of general insurance education preferred.
